TextBox de recherche sur feuille et non pas sur USF

Bonjour à tous,

J'ai un petit fichier sur lequel j'ajoute des entrées avec différentes données. A chaque clic sur le bouton enregistrer, les données sont stockées dans l'onglet "validations" et la feuille redevient vierge pour insérer de nouvelles données.

Afin de retrouver un document validé j'ai ajouté, sur la feuille principale (SCAN), un TextBox et un petit bouton de recherche.

Je souhaiterais que ce bouton de recherche ouvre l'onglet validations et filtre la colonne A avec ce qui est indiqué dans la text box.

Pour ce fait j'ai cette macro mais qui ne marche pas vraiment bien:

Sub CommandButton_valider_Click()

  'La cellule A1 de la feuille validation obtient la valeur de la zone de texte nommée "RECHERCHEBOX"
    Sheets("validation").Select
    Range("A1") = Sheets("SCAN").RECHERCHEBOX

'Je filtre la colonne A par le texte situé sur A1:

    Range("A2:A25000").Select

    'J'enlève d'abord les filtres qu'il pourrait y avoir:
    If ActiveSheet.FilterMode = True Then ActiveSheet.ShowAllData

'Je filtre selon l'info en A1
    ActiveSheet.Range("$A$2:$A$" & Range("A" & Rows.Count).End(xlUp).Row).AutoFilter Field:=1, Criteria1:=[A1]

    Range("A1").Select

If Range("B1") = "0" Then MsgBox "Aucune valeur trouvée.", vbCritical, "ERREUR!"

End Sub

Merci pour votre aide.

Patrick.

Bonjour Patrick, le forum,

Un fichier (sans données confidentielles) peut-être ?

Cordialement,

Rechercher des sujets similaires à "textbox recherche feuille pas usf"